Avoiding Foreclosure: Your Choices and Privileges

Facing foreclosure can be a stressful experience, but understand that you are entitled to options. Do not simply dismiss the issue; actively explore your potential courses of action. These include contacting your bank to negotiate a loan modification, pursuing a short sale which allows you to market your property for below the outstanding debt, or submitting for financial restructuring, which may give brief protection from repossession. Furthermore, you are entitled to certain consumer rights, including the right to obtain warning regarding the home loss process and the chance to dispute the financial institution's actions. Seek professional assistance from a housing counselor or an legal representative to fully evaluate your situation and defend your rights.
